Though exercising is a must for everybody, certain physical conditions prevent us from doing the usual exercises, since it means subjecting the body to lot of impact. Regular exercises like running and weight-training subjects your body and its various joints to a lot of impact. So if you are recovering from some form of injury, or if you are a pregnant woman, or if you have been facing health problems like weak joints or arthritis, it may not be advisable for you to take up those form of exercises - like running or weigh training.

But then one needs to stay fit. So the best alternative in such a case is to go in for Water Exercises! Water related exercise is a great way to workout your body without straining any of your joints.
